Commit Graph

20 Commits

Author SHA1 Message Date
f4cc9498cb add mutexs to prevent data races, re-organize a bit 2021-01-06 19:12:56 -05:00
db0af7edcd remove global conf and state variables 2021-01-05 20:25:38 -05:00
ac800167f6 discord event listeners use non-global state 2021-01-05 20:21:08 -05:00
bcd7ee97ba mumble event listeners use non-global state 2021-01-05 19:43:55 -05:00
4ae6176991 use gumble.Client.Do for sending messages thread safely 2021-01-05 19:08:17 -05:00
1e8a0a4165 count how many users are actually in channel 2021-01-05 19:00:28 -05:00
c469a65ed6 begin switching to mumble event listeners 2021-01-05 13:16:03 -05:00
d75fff08f2 readme update 2021-01-05 12:16:51 -05:00
b7b1065abb use mumble client more,finally get user count right 2021-01-05 11:41:33 -05:00
2aa1a32d64 don't add users before the bridge starts 2021-01-04 21:54:29 -05:00
8f5caaf834 actually add user to set 2021-01-04 20:53:03 -05:00
41e864a0f3 send message when user leaves too 2021-01-03 20:52:30 -05:00
b782efdf04 keep track of discord users in set 2021-01-03 20:48:34 -05:00
8257bf55ab only care about joins, not mutes/deafens 2021-01-03 20:29:56 -05:00
f1f59116b5 don't try to send message before we connect to mumble 2021-01-03 20:25:51 -05:00
f63b9d005c send message in mumble when user joins in discord 2021-01-03 20:20:03 -05:00
4b8e6eea55 use user counting, add discord buffer debuf, intial auto mode 2021-01-03 15:32:59 -05:00
ca1ba1d099 more cleanup on manual linkage, attempts to get discord->mumble working 2020-12-29 18:19:44 -05:00
2df391f0d9 less channel span, add refresh command 2020-12-29 15:23:43 -05:00
5a96c488ee initial changes, make it manual linking, show mumble users in status 2020-12-29 15:14:19 -05:00